In the UK, the Dental practitioner Act was come on 1878 and the British Dental Association created in 1879. In the very same year, Francis Brodie Imlach was the very first dentist to be elected Head of state of the Royal University of Surgeons (Edinburgh), elevating dental care onto a par with scientific surgical treatment for the very first time.


Sound exposure can create excessive stimulation of the hearing mechanism, which harms the fragile frameworks of the inner ear. NIHL can occur when a person is exposed to seem levels above 90 dBA according to the Occupational Security and Wellness Management (OSHA). Regulations specify that the permissible sound direct exposure levels for individuals is 90 dBA.


Direct exposures below 85 dBA are ruled out to be harmful. Time frame are positioned on for how long an individual can remain in a setting above 85 dBA before it creates hearing loss. OSHA positions that restriction at 8 hours for 85 dBA. The exposure time ends up being shorter as the dBA degree boosts.

While a majority of the tools do not exceed 75 dBA, long term direct exposure over years can cause hearing loss or complaints of ringing in the ears. Few dental practitioners have reported utilizing individual hearing safety gadgets, which might counter any type of prospective hearing loss or ringing in the ears. There is a motion in modern dental care to put a better focus on top notch clinical evidence in decision-making.


It is an approach to oral wellness that requires the application and examination of relevant scientific information associated with the patient's oral and medical health and wellness. Along with the dental practitioner's professional ability and expertise, EBD allows dental experts to keep up to date on the current procedures and individuals to obtain enhanced therapy.
